> Tip: Keep a journal to track your emotions and patterns. Over time, you’ll start noticing what situations tend to push your buttons—and how you can respond more effectively.
> Tip: When overwhelmed, practice deep breathing, meditation, or grounding techniques to regain control before reacting emotionally.
> Tip: When facing a tough situation, ask yourself: “What’s one small positive thing I can take away from this?” Shifting your perspective can change everything.
> Tip: Make it a habit to reach out to loved ones—not just when things go wrong, but regularly. Strong bonds are built over time.
> Tip: Get enough sleep, exercise, eat well, and set boundaries to protect your peace. A well-nourished mind is a strong mind.
